Outgoing Prison CG Approves Promotion of 5,900 Officers

Dele Ogbodo in Abuja

The outgoing Comptroller-General of the Nigerian Prison Service (NPS), Mr. Peter Ekpendu, on Tuesday said he has approved the promotion of 5,900 officers.

Speaking at the pull-out ceremony organised for him at the headquarters of the service in Abuja, he said his tenure was characterized with petitions from both within and outside the Service.

The former Comptroller-General who described the petitions as frivolous, said he stood by whatever action he took while in office as the CG of the Prisons service.

Despite the deluge of petition that flooded the minister’s office, he said he had to approve the promotion of 5,900 officers and men of the service as a parting gift.

Ekpendu, who joined NPS twenty six years ago, however admitted that he had no regret of any actions taken while in office as the Prisons Comptroller General.

He said: “I stand by whatever I did throughout my tenure and I also stand by it.”
